Great mix of herbs, oriental and woody-spicy-smoky notes
I am surprised that this great fragrance has not yet received a review. It deserves it, especially since it has already been on the market for about 3 years. A few statements and a good rating here at 8.0 already indicate that this is already a very good release. I think the Ojar brand from the UAE is very underrated. They have a cool range that is not just exclusively oriental fragrances like other brands from Dubai. The fragrances Infusion Velours Eau de Parfum and Wood Whisper Eau de Parfum are somewhat more popular, while the others from this brand are often neglected. i also find Stallion Soul Eau de Parfum and this Ciel d'Orage Eau de Parfum very good, Stallion Soul is even my favorite of this brand. A high-quality brand that also sells body oil and perfume oil. The RRP for the EdPs may be a bit daunting at €200 per 100ml, but you can get most of them for half that price. This Ciel D'Orage is also currently available for half the price, which is absolutely fair for this quality.
The packaging of this brand is cool and not too voluminous, yet luxurious and quite niche. The bottles are also top-notch and very well made. The lid fits perfectly and the glass is high quality. The color combinations also look extremely classy. The atomizer is as smooth as butter and for me a 10 out of 10. In the overall package, including the P-L ratio, a great choice.
This Ciel D'Orage is already a multi-talent that combines many facets: wood, spices, herbs, rose, some oud, smoke, oriental notes, green nuances. And this fragrance is never too heavy and can also be used in warmer temperatures without any problems. The herbs and green notes give it a slight wellness touch. However, I primarily wear it in autumnal temperatures and also in the evening. It has a rather masculine touch and men are more likely to be interested in this fragrance. Nevertheless, this fragrance is not unbearable for women. The pyramid is only reflected to a limited extent and blind buys are rather daring. If you like herbaceous and spicy fragrances, there is a good chance that you will like this fragrance. Right from the start, you get herbs and spices with a slight oriental touch. A pleasant saffron spice, herbs, rose, subtle oud and slightly smoky notes can be found in the opening. It is never too heavy and never overwhelming. When the top note recedes a little, a great pine note comes through, which provides a great green and relaxing vibe. Beautiful guaiac wood also comes through well and accompanies this great spicy-herbal-green note. Leather also comes through well, but is more in the background. Very soft leather, which has a very sensual touch. Smoky styrax is also present and has a relaxing and slightly sweet vibe. The drydown is definitely very pleasant. Overall, a fragrance that has a lot of elegance and is far removed from the usual bestseller styles.
Performance is absolutely top here. It lasts well over 10 hours with a very good sillage that gives a relaxing vibe and is not overpowering. A carefree package, especially when you are out and about.
Worth a test here. As I said, you should like herbs, spices, light smoke, wood and oriental notes. A worthwhile purchase for half the price of the RRP.
